← Back to opportunities

Senior Software Engineer C# - FLEXIBLE WORKING

📍 Location
london
⏰ Job Type
Full-time
📅 Posted
June 08, 2026

About the Role

Senior Software Engineer | ~£950/day Outside IR35 | 6-months initial contract | London
Industry: Trading
Job Type: Contract - 6-month initial
Our client is building the next generation of execution and order management (EMS/OMS) infrastructure for global commodities trading. You will join a small, fast-moving engineering team designing and delivering a cloud-native trading platform from the ground up, tightly integrated with risk, pricing, and market data systems to support high-performance trading environments.
This is a senior, hands-on role for an engineer who wants end-to-end ownership — from low-level protocol integration through to distributed execution services and trader-facing tooling.
Develop low-latency, distributed execution services with a strong focus on correctness, resilience, and performance under load.
Collaborate closely with traders, quants, and risk engineers to translate trading workflows and execution strategies into robust production syst...

Ready to Join Through a Referral?

Apply now and get connected directly with the hiring team

Apply for this Position